Job summary Job Title: Digital Care Co-ordinator Hours of work : Up to 37.5 (minimum 18.75 for part-time) per week Remuneration : £25,642.50 -£28,000 per annum dependent on experience (pro-rata for fixed term contract and part-time) Contract length : Fixed term until 31 March (with potential … Main duties of the job The Haringey GP Federation is supporting practices across Camden and Haringey with a new and innovative service called the Health Technology Adoption Accelerator Fund (HTAAF). This service aims to achieve an integrated, end-to-end pathway for managing Heart Failure across primary care … secondary care and community services. We are looking for a bright and committed Digital Care Coordinator to support the project. As a Digital Care Coordinator, you will work closely with clinicians and patients as a central point of contact to ensure appropriate support is made available to them more »
